单片机控制IO口输出高低电平的原理是什么?

如题所述

第1个回答  2022-11-16
名称:IO口高低电平控制\x0d\x0a  #include //包含头文件,一般情况不需要改动,头文件\x0d\x0a  包含特殊功能寄存器的定义\x0d\x0a  /*------------------------------------------------\x0d\x0a  主函数\x0d\x0a  ------------------------------------------------*/\x0d\x0a  void main (void)\x0d\x0a  {\x0d\x0a  P1 = 0xFF; //P1口全部为高电平,对应的LED灯全灭掉,ff\x0d\x0a  换算成二进制是 1111 1111\x0d\x0a  P1 = 0xfe; //P1口的最低位点亮,可以更改数值是其他的\x0d\x0a  灯点亮\x0d\x0a  //0xfe是16进制,0x开头表示16进制数,fe换\x0d\x0a  算成二进制是 1111 1110\x0d\x0a  while (1) //主循环\x0d\x0a  {\x0d\x0a  //主循环中添加其他需要一直工作的程序\x0d\x0a  }\x0d\x0a  }